From sceptic to convert!
I tried quite a few cables with my turntable, from one the one supplied with it, to others I bought and returned. I was very sceptical as the price was really at the top end of what I wanted to pay for an interconnect (£20 is plenty on a short cable and I’m not wowed by cables costing hundreds). Anyway, when it arrived it seemed when made so I plugged it in and it really solved the problems I’d been having with hum and noise. I just heard the music, which is what I wanted, and the bass and top end were more refined and not ragged as with some of the cables. It might not make too much different to CD, or tape desk, or streaming device, but I’ve discovered turntables are very fussy due to the very low output of the styles and so a low noise interconnect is important. Also, with MM cartridges low capacitance is very important and these Mogami cables have a low capacitance value (only beaten by the Blue Jean LC1 which is 50% over my budget). Overall a good value cable for turntables. Not too cheap that you don’t know what you’re getting, but not so expensive you feel short changed when you plug it in!
